Arsenal: Arsenal’s transfer window came to a quiet close, raising questions about squad depth in key positions like midfield. To make matters worse, star player Thomas Partey suffered a groin injury. Yet, amid these concerns, Jorginho’s recent decision to stay at Arsenal takes center stage.
According to 90 Min, Jorginho has firmly decided to stick with Arsenal. Despite receiving offers from both the Scottish Premier League and Fenerbahce, the Italian midfielder remains committed to the Gunners. This news comes after Arsenal concluded their summer business without any last-minute additions. Earlier, they had made four signings and offloaded some of their surplus talents.
This transfer strategy left some fans concerned. Specifically, they worried about the depth in midfield and central defense. The situation intensified when Thomas Partey got sidelined due to injury. Reports suggest he could be out for up to six weeks, missing important clashes against Manchester United, Everton, and Tottenham. Arsenal signed Declan Rice to mitigate this loss, but another essential player now emerges in the spotlight: Jorginho.
Jorginho arrived at Arsenal last January from Chelsea for a £12 million deal. In the latter half of the previous season, he featured 16 times for the club. Arsenal’s manager, Mikel Arteta, views Jorginho as a vital part of his tactical system. Despite the recent signing of Rice, Jorginho’s role has not diminished. Arteta intends to utilize him extensively, especially in Partey’s absence.
Before this recent news broke, rumors had started circulating that Jorginho might seek a move. Fenerbahce seemed especially interested, capitalizing on the still-open Turkish transfer window. Yet, when it comes down to it, Jorginho declined their offer. He also rejected another bid from a Saudi club, signifying his commitment to Arsenal.
